Second Stage | Amherst, Inc, as a community cultural organization, provides a place for education, entertainment, and enrichment. Our building is a government property that is leased to Second Stage; we operate as a free and open forum. We believe that public discourse and a free marketplace of ideas are the bedrock of a strong democracy. All programs at Second Stage will enjoy the protection of freedom of speech, whether produced by Second Stage, its long-term tenants or organizations and individuals unrelated to Second Stage who utilize its short-term rental spaces. These protections and privileges, however, will only be allowed in the spirit of tolerance, respect, and common decency. We do not condone programs or productions whose words or actions inflict injury, incite a breach of the peace, provoke violence, engender discrimination on the basis of race, religion, gender, or creed, or otherwise run counter to law. The Board of Directors of Second Stage reserves the right to refuse or to halt, even in mid-production, any program that is determined to be counter to these stipulations or does not serve the mission of the organization. An offending individual or organization may be henceforth prohibited from access to Second Stage. |
In 2015, Second Stage | Amherst signed a five-year lease with Amherst County allowing this not-for-profit organization the opportunity to convert the historic building into a center for creativity and community!
We have installed handicapped-accessible facilities, repainted the beautiful pressed metal ceiling in the performance space, and upgraded the HVAC systems. The original pews have been replaced with stackable chairs for flexible space use. Our studio spaces are rented by artists, classes and small businesses. Many area organizations are holding regular meetings in our public spaces. |
